课程设置
Modules:模块
Three taught core modules (15 credits each):三个教学核心模块 (每个15学分)
Group project (30 credits):团体项目 (30学分)
Individual research project (60 credits):个人研究项目 (60学分)
Three taught optional modules (15 credits each):三个教学可选模块 (每个15学分)
Core Modules:核心模块
Fundamentals of Predictive Modelling (ES98ALink opens in a new window) (15 credit):预测建模基础 (ES98ALink在新窗口中打开) (15 credit)
Numerical Algorithms and Optimisation (MA934Link opens in a new window) (15 credit):数值算法和优化 (MA934Link在新窗口中打开) (15 credit)
Scientific Machine Learning (ES98ELink opens in a new window) (15 credit):科学机器学习 (ES98ELink在新窗口中打开) (15 credit)
Example project titles include::示例项目标题包括:
Predictive modelling of composite materials for hydrogen storage:储氢复合材料的预测模型
Data-driven discovery of differential equations for interfacial flows:界面流动微分方程的数据驱动发现
Multi-physics approaches for rocking wave bioreactors:摇摆波生物反应器的多物理方法
Bouncing drop dynamics across scales:跨尺度弹跳液滴动力学
Generation of nickel-based superalloy structures with realistic short-range ordering:具有现实短程有序的镍基高温合金结构的生成
